百度
360搜索
搜狗搜索

svn是什么意思,svn是什么意思?详细介绍

本文目录一览: svn是什么

svn是什么?回答如下:
SVN全名Subversion,即版本控制系统。SVN与CVS一样,是一个跨平台的软件,支持大多数常见的操作系统。作为一个开源的版本控制系统,Subversion 管理着随时间改变的数据。这些数据放置在一个中央资料档案库 (repository) 中。
这个档案库很像一个普通的文件服务器, 不过它会记住每一次文件的变动。这样你就可以把档案恢复到旧的版本, 或是浏览文件的变动历史。Subversion 是一个通用的系统, 可用来管理任何类型的文件, 其中包括了程序源码。
SVN = 版本控制 + 备份服务器简单的说,您可以把SVN当成您的备份服务器,更好的是,他可以帮您记住每次上传到这个服务器的档案内容。并且自动的赋予每次的变更一个版本。通常,我们称用来存放上传档案的地方就做Repository。
用中文来说,有点像是档案仓库的意思。不过,通常我们还是使用Repository这个名词。基本上,第一次我们需要有一个新增(add)档案的动作,将想要备份的档案放到Repository上面。日后,当您有任何修改时,都可以上传到 Repository上面,上传已经存在且修改过的档案就叫做commit,也就是提交修改给SVN server的意思。
针对每次的commit,SVN server都会赋予他一个新的版本。同时,也会把每次上传的时间记录下来。日后,因为某些因素,如果您需要从Repository下载曾经提交的档案。您可以直接选择取得最新的版本,也可以取得任何一个之前的版本。如果忘记了版本,还是可以靠记忆尝试取得某个日期的版本。

svn是什么意思?

svn是一个版本管理工具,望采纳
svn(subversion)是近年来崛起的版本管理工具,是cvs的接班人。目前,绝大多数开源软件都用svn作为代码版本管理软件。
SVN是Subversion的简称,是一个开放源代码的版本控制系统,相较于RCS、CVS,它采用了分支管理系统,它的设计目标就是取代CVS。互联网上很多版本控制服务已从CVS迁移到Subversion。说得简单一点SVN就是用于多个人共同开发同一个项目,共用资源的目的。
svn [医][=superior vestibular nerve]前庭上神经;

什么是SVN以及SVN的作用

SVN = 版本控制 + 备份服务器简单的说,您可以把SVN当成您的备份服务器,更好的是,他可以帮您记住每次上传到这个服务器的档案内容。并且自动的赋予每次的变更一个版本。
通常,我们称用来存放上传档案的地方就做Repository。用中文来说,有点像是档案仓库的意思。不过,通常我们还是使用Repository这个名词。基本上,第一次我们需要有一个新增(add)档案的动作,将想要备份的档案放到Repository上面。日后,当您有任何修改时,都可以上传到 Repository上面,上传已经存在且修改过的档案就叫做commit,也就是提交修改给SVN server的意思。针对每次的commit,SVN server都会赋予他一个新的版本。同时,也会把每次上传的时间记录下来。日后,因为某些因素,如果您需要从Repository下载曾经提交的档案。您可以直接选择取得最新的版本,也可以取得任何一个之前的版本。如果忘记了版本,还是可以靠记忆尝试取得某个日期的版本。
SVN是subversion的缩写,是一个开放源代码的版本控制系统,通过采用分支管理系统的高效管理,简而言之就是用于多个人共同开发同一个项目,实现共享资源,实现最终集中式的管理。
SVN的作用:SVN是一种技术性更加安全的产品,的实现了系统和控制两方面的结合。一方面可以将系统整体的安全功能有效地分布在分支系统中,进而保证分支系统能正常运行,从而使各分支系统能够互补,最终在系统整体性的安全性得以保障,通过均衡原则实现最终追求安全的目的。
扩展资料:
SVN服务器既具有CVS所具有数据储存的优点,像是信息资源存储后会形成资源树结构,便于存储的同时,数据一般不会丢失,同时又拥有自己的特色。SVN是通过关系数据库及二进制的存储方式,同时解决了既往不能同时读写同一文件等问题,同时增添了自己特有的“零或一”原则。
参考资料来源:百度百科-版本控制
参考资料来源:百度百科-SVN

subversion-repository是什么意思

subversion-repository
Subversion版本库
repository
[英][r??p?z?tri][美][r??pɑ:z?t?:ri]
n.仓库; 贮藏室; 博物馆; 亲信;
复数:repositories
Subversion是一个自由,开源的版本控制系统。在Subversion管理下,文件和目录可以超越时空。Subversion将文件存放在中心版本库里。这个版本库很像一个普通的文件服务器,不同的是,它可以记录每一次文件和目录的修改情况。这样就可以籍此将数据恢复到以前的版本,并可以查看数据的更改细节。正因为如此,许多人将版本控制系统当作一种神奇的“时间机器”
.——————————————
很高兴为你解答!
如有不懂,请追问。 谢谢!
subversion-repository即SVN 中心版本库。
其中Subversion即SVN,是一个自由,开源的版本控制系统。在Subversion管理下,文件和目录可以超越时空。Subversion将文件存放在中心版本库里。这个版本库很像一个普通的文件服务器,不同的是,它可以记录每一次文件和目录的修改情况。
Repository是指数据的中央存储仓库,Repository以filesystem tree的形式存放信息。若干clinet(客户端)连接到repository并读、写文件,因此SVN是一个典型的client/server架构。
【单词含义】
subversion 英 [s?b'v?:?n] 美 [s?b?v???n, -??n]
n. 破坏; (活动) 颠覆; 覆灭,瓦解
repository 英 [r??p?z?tri] 美 [r??pɑ:z?t?:ri]
n. 仓库; 贮藏室; 博物馆; 亲信

ticket,SVN,wiki是什么意思?

在常用的软件开发项目的管理工具中,ticket通常是指任务单,一个ticket就对应一个工作任务,比如一个待开发的功能,或者一个待编程的类文件,或者一个待修复的bug等等
SVN是一款文件版本管理软件,常用于实现项目组所有成员的代码集中管理
通常一个软件开发项目常用这三类工具:
1、版本管理软件,如SVN、Git、vss、cvs等
2、任务/缺陷管理软件,如redmine、TRAC、jira等
3、wiki类的文档在线编辑软件

按下手机#06#键后显示出IMEI和另一项SVN,请问SVN是什么意思

svn(subversion)是近年来崛起的版本管理工具,因为它是一款开源的管理软件,所以大多数手机开发商会使用这款工具。SVN所显示的代码是指的手机开发商所设定的系统版本。
如果我的回答对您有帮助,请采纳,乐趣在线joyrom官方团队为您解答。

vsvn什么意思

VisualSVN是一个计算机系统函数。
VisualSVN Server是免费的,而VisualSVN是收费的。VisualSVN是SVN的客户端,和Visual Studio集成在一起,VisualSvn Server是SVN的服务器端,包括Subversion、Apache和用户及权限管理,优点在上面已经说过了。
VisualSVN Server是免费的,而VisualSVN是收费的。VisualSVN是SVN的客户端,和Visual Studio集成在一起,VisualSvn Server是SVN的服务器端,包括Subversion、Apache和用户及权限管理,优点在上面已经说过了。

svn中有的代码被标注黄色,绿色和红色,分别表示什么意思呢?

紫色:标识新增。棕色:标识删除。绿色:标识成功归并。亮红:标识冲。
红色感叹号代表修改,黄色感叹号代表冲突,灰色对号代表只读文件夹,红色差号代表删除,黄色锁代表被锁定,蓝色加号代表新增,灰色减号代表被忽略,问号代表未修改。
扩展资料:
SVN这个档案库很像一个普通的文件服务器,不过它会记住每一次文件的变动。这样就可以把档案恢复到旧的版本,或是浏览文件的变动历史。Subversion是一个通用的系统,可用来管理任何类型的文件,其中包括程序源码。
SVN采用客户端/服务器体系,项目的各种版本都存储在服务器上,程序开发人员首先将从服务器上获得一份项目的最新版本,并将其复制到本机,然后在此基础上,每个开发人员可以在自己的客户端进行独立的开发工作,并且可以随时将新代码提交给服务器。
当然也可以通过更新操作获取服务器上的最新代码,从而保持与其他开发者所使用版本的一致性。
SVN的客户端有两类,一类是基于Web的WebSVN等,另一类是以Tortoise SVN为代表的客户端软件。前者需要Web服务器的支持,后者需要用户在本地安装客户端,两种都有免费的开源软件供使用。
SVN存储版本数据也两种方式:BDB(一种事务安全型表类型)和FSFS(一种不需要数据库的存储系统)。因为BDB方式在服务器中断时,有可能锁住数据,所以还是FSFS方式更安全一点。
参考资料来源:svn官网-代码简介
参考资料来源:百度百科-SVN

SVN不是工作的副本是什么意思?

神啦,终于弄懂了。被这个问题困扰了好久。。想哭了。\x0d\x0a1.SVN:不是工作副本\x0d\x0alinux的svn操作都要是在工作副本里面,也就是要在你用svncheckout命令下载的某个版本文件的目录中,然后再修改这个版本文件的内容,最后在当前文件夹下用svncommit才能成功。\x0d\x0a2.svmcommit不成功(每一次提交都会有提交内容显示的)\x0d\x0a很有可能就是隐藏的.svn文件被误删了(可以用ls-a查看是否有.svn文件,这个),值得注意的你这个版本文件下的每个文件夹下都会有一个隐藏的.svn文件。解决的办法是你重新下载你当前版本的版本内容,把里面的.svn文件都移动你进行当前已经修改的版本文件相应的目录下。提交就可以成功了。

阅读更多 >>>  linuxftp用户命令

网站数据信息

"svn是什么意思,svn是什么意思?"浏览人数已经达到16次,如你需要查询该站的相关权重信息,可以点击进入"Chinaz数据" 查询。更多网站价值评估因素如:svn是什么意思,svn是什么意思?的访问速度、搜索引擎收录以及索引量、用户体验等。 要评估一个站的价值,最主要还是需要根据您自身的需求,如网站IP、PV、跳出率等!